>> Nirved, AMD developers announced here in the list they'll be working on
>> splitting the Cycles megakernel to smaller kernels, similar to wavefront
>> path tracer paper.
>>
>>
>> So my guess would be that it's more productive to collaborate on that
>> work instead of initializing new one.
